Question: Please Help Java course how to copy the variable, i, in the for loop to the variable, index ?? int i; int index; for (i
Please Help Java course how to copy the variable, i, in the for loop to the variable, index ?? int i; int index; for (i = 1; i < 10; i++) { if (numbers[i] > maximum) { maximum = numbers[i]; System.out.println("maximum = " + maximum + " numbers[i]= " + numbers[i]); } index=i; } System.out.println("maximum = " + maximum + " numbers[i]= " + numbers[index]); numbers[i] = minimum; output:
Enter 10 double numbers between 1 to 100 2 3 4 5 6 7 8 9 10 3 maximum = 3.0 numbers[i]= 3.0 maximum = 4.0 numbers[i]= 4.0 maximum = 5.0 numbers[i]= 5.0 maximum = 6.0 numbers[i]= 6.0 maximum = 7.0 numbers[i]= 7.0 maximum = 8.0 numbers[i]= 8.0 maximum = 9.0 numbers[i]= 9.0 maximum = 10.0 numbers[i]= 10.0 Exception in thread "main" java.lang.ArrayIndexOutOfBoundsException: 10 at SmallesElement.main(SmallesElement.java:38)
index variable not initialized
Step by Step Solution
There are 3 Steps involved in it
Get step-by-step solutions from verified subject matter experts
